The carpet in our motorhome is secured by two plastic discs (one each side) which are located in the worst possible place. Right underneath where your heel goes!
I noticed during a recent six week tour of Europe, that these discs have a habit of coming adrift and allowing the carpet to move about, sometimes dangerously under the pedals and affecting braking, etc. Sods law, one of these on the drivers side was lost and must have fell out of the cab. Leaving me no alternative but to 'borrow' the one from the passenger side.
I wonder if anyone can offer advice on where to get replacements from, i.e. main Fiat dealer; Autotrail or Ebay, etc., or if they have come up with a better solution to this design flaw?
